## Onboarding: Farebranch Rules Engine

Plugin authors integrate with Farebranch by registering fee rules against the evaluation API. Rules are sandboxed; they cannot perform network calls directly. All rate-table lookups go through the host, which validates your plugin manifest at load time. Your local env file must include the signing credential the host uses to verify manifests, set on the next line.

secret setting of bajef-fajof: COURIER_KEY3=76c

Handover note: Sweepline retention sweeper (for plugin authors)

Passing Sweepline maintenance from me to Odele. Key things for anyone writing retention plugins: the sweeper now batches deletions per tenant, so your plugin's hooks fire once per batch, not per record. Dry-run mode is default in staging — flip the flag deliberately. The plugin conformance suite lives in the harness repo and must pass before any release. To run the harness against the encrypted sample dataset, unlock it with the recovery passphrase below.

unlock words, hahip-baduf: holwyn-istath-julvan

## Authentication

Matchbox (the pairing service) exposes GC pause metrics at `/internal/gc`. Pauses over 400ms page on-call. The endpoint is behind the Kestrelgate proxy; anonymous calls return 403. Auth is a static service key in the `X-Matchbox-Key` header — no OAuth, no refresh. Keys rotate quarterly; stale keys fail closed, which looks identical to a network partition, so check auth first. The current on-call key for the GC metrics endpoint is below.

API key for kahap-faduf: vxb23-Ir087IkWYmBJt7KRtkyhUA3